What is a permit parking area?

Controlled Parking Zones (CPZ) are areas where all on-street parking is controlled during specific times. To park within a CPZ during controlled hours you must display a valid resident, visitor or business permit, or if parking within a pay and display bay, a valid parking ticket.

Can I park where it says permit holders only?

In many parts of London there are parking bays that are reserved for certain users. In certain areas parking is set aside for permit holders only, for example local residents. … During controlled hours you must not park in a permit holders’ bay without a permit.

Can you park in permit holders only on bank holidays?

If the resident bay is not controlled on a Sunday, parking on a bank or public holiday without a valid resident permit is allowed. A sign stating ‘Resident permit holders only’ with no days or times quoted indicates that the bay is controlled at all times, every day, including on public and Bank holidays.

How much is a parking permit in Los Angeles?

Annual Permits are valid for one year and each household is limited to three Annual Permits (except where special conditions have been assigned by City Council). Preferential Parking permits cost $34.00 each per year, and Overnight Parking permits cost $15.00 each per year. Permits may be purchased for the full year.

Can I sleep in my car in San Francisco?

Currently, it is illegal to sleep overnight in your car in San Francisco. The city prohibits people from inhabiting cars from 10 p.m. to 6 a.m.. and offenders can face a $1,000 fine or six months in jail.

Can I use blue painters tape on my car?

Blue Painter’s tape (better than the tan kind of masking tape, but more expensive) will not stick to or damage your car’s existing paint (unless it’s very fresh!) as long as you don’t leave the tape on for a long time (e.g., several weeks or months, in which case it may be more difficult to remove without a solvent …
